About This Home

This 2 BR, 1,1/2 bath is a diamond in the ruff with great possibilities for expansion. Feature's include hardwood floors thru out, storm windows and ALL BRICK. With 2 fireplaces and huge bedrooms, this property is a great starter home or wonderful for downsizing. Located close to Hwy 15 and I-20, an easy commute to Florence, Shaw AFB, Hartsville or Fort Jackson.
